If You Need to have Help Paying for Your Prescriptions
You absolutely do not want to stop taking your prescription medication. There are quite a lot of programs to be had which provide free and reduced cost medicines assistance.
• Social Services- Most hospitals boast a social worker who should help you acquire grants and other programs aimed at helping you with your healthcare needs. This should be your opening stop in looking for help. At all times inform your doctor if you cannot pay for drugs or care. He or she might know of a plan personally to support you, as well.
• Partnership for Patient Assistance- The Partnership for Patient Assistance is a business aimed at helping folks that can not afford their prescription medicine. They have created a database of over 500 programs and in excess of 5000 prescription medication offered for reduced or no cost aid. They lend a hand in determining what you are eligible for and applying for the aid. The service is free and offered online.
• Prescription drug Companies- A large number of residents would not think drug companies provide help, although some will. Gsk provides a prescription medicine plan for those taking their prescription medication and cannot meet the expense of them. Discover the manufacturer of the drugs by asking your doctor of medicine or pharmacist and try out the website for medication assistance programs.
You are not the only one with this predicament. While it’s easy to feel uncomfortable, there’s no reason to be ashamed.
